Where do I find the law for California will contests, probate litigation, and trust litigation?
The law for California will contests, probate litigation, and trust litigation is mostly found in the California Probate Code.

What is the difference between trust litigation and financial elder abuse litigation?
Generally, from a beneficiary’s perspective, the difference between trust litigation and financial elder abuse litigation is when the money or property was wrongfully taken.
